Department Description: Wilson Health''s Patients'' Account Department is responsible for handling the hospital billing and collection aspects of the patient's care during the service date (The date/date(s) when care was provided to the patient from the hospital or provider).
Job Summary: The Billing Specialist is responsible for releasing insurance claims electronically and mails hard copy UB/1500 claims as required.
The Billing Specialist will also follow up on unpaid claims and rebill or appeal claims as indicated.
Essential Duties & Responsibilities:
Billing of claims through EPIC and Electronic Vendor (Quadax) which requires keeping up to date with Payer requirements and/or edits.
Prior experience with Medicare facility billing experience required
Submits claim electronically or hard copy for MSP claims with appropriate information from the primary payer.
Bills secondary, tertiary, etc. claims electronically or mails the UB/1500 with EOB as required by Payer.
Monitors claims using the Medicare and or Quadax online system
Works closely with all departments throughout the hospital regarding charges and/or late charges.
Responsible for the follow up of submitted claims to primary, secondary, and tertiary payers
Works the 30 day and out worklist in EMR and contacts Payers via phone or Payer website regarding no pays.
Appeals claims on behalf of the patient to secure payment or if a claim has been denied for inappropriate reasons. Biller or Collector will follow up on the Appeal.
Works with Case Management and Medical Records regarding RAC audits, other audits, and inpatient denials.
Works mail as it applies to the Biller or Collector to secure payment.
Works closely with Central Scheduling/Registration, Case Management and Medical Records regarding Denials for No Authorizations and/or Medical Necessity to secure appropriate documentation and/or diagnosis to submit a corrected claim or appeal
